John Brown A Low-End Starting Option In Week 5
                
        
        Buffalo Bills wide receiver John  Brown leads the team in receiving yards (318) and has had a solid target share of 23.1% through four weeks. This week, the Bills take on the Titans in a tough matchup that could see them relying on No. 2 quarterback Matt  Barkley as starter Josh  Allen (concussion) is currently questionable for Week 5. If Barkley indeed starts, Brown is a low-end WR3/flex play at best and you might be wise to avoid him if you have other options. If Allen plays, Brown's value gets a boost, but not a huge boost. With Allen he'd have a safer floor and you'd feel better about him as your WR3/flex.
